G. I. Lykasov is a scholar working on Nuclear and High Energy Physics, Atomic and Molecular Physics, and Optics and Biomedical Engineering. According to data from OpenAlex, G. I. Lykasov has authored 67 papers receiving a total of 452 indexed citations (citations by other indexed papers that have themselves been cited), including 65 papers in Nuclear and High Energy Physics, 4 papers in Atomic and Molecular Physics, and Optics and 2 papers in Biomedical Engineering. Recurrent topics in G. I. Lykasov’s work include Quantum Chromodynamics and Particle Interactions (58 papers), Particle physics theoretical and experimental studies (57 papers) and High-Energy Particle Collisions Research (55 papers). G. I. Lykasov is often cited by papers focused on Quantum Chromodynamics and Particle Interactions (58 papers), Particle physics theoretical and experimental studies (57 papers) and High-Energy Particle Collisions Research (55 papers). G. I. Lykasov collaborates with scholars based in Russia, Italy and United States. G. I. Lykasov's co-authors include V. A. Bednyakov, A. V. Lipatov, W. Cassing, M. A. Malyshev and Omar Benhar and has published in prestigious journals such as Physics Letters B, Nuclear Physics A and EPL (Europhysics Letters).
